If the Starboard pro is the 9'1 x 29" then I have ridden them both back to back. I usually ride the 8'5 Pocket Rocket and like it.

I found the Pro a little less stable. I thought the Pro might have more glide, but I didnt notice it. I found the Pro stiffer to turn as well.

To sum it up, I didnt find any positives in the Pro over the Pocket Rocket. I will be keeping what Ive got.
